Course Content


Autonomy and Informed Consent in Healthcare

Bioethics and Medical Decision Making

Cultural Competence in Healthcare Policy

Healthcare Access and Equity

Healthcare Law and Regulation

Healthcare Policy Analysis and Evaluation

Healthcare Quality Improvement and Patient Safety

Healthcare Systems and Organizational Ethics

Medical Research Ethics and Governance

Public Health Ethics and Policy
